The Sound of Thunder

The sound of thunder is one of the most recognizable and primal sounds in the world. It is the sound of raw power and energy, a reminder of the forces that shape our planet. Thunder can be heard for miles around, and its booming echoes can rattle windows and shake the ground beneath our feet.

The Wrath of Tornadoes

Tornadoes are one of the most destructive natural occurrences, capable of tearing apart entire communities in a matter of minutes. The sound of a tornado is a chilling one, a high-pitched whine that seems to come from all around. The wind is so powerful that it can make buildings crumble and toss cars through the air like toys.

The Fury of Fire

Fire is another force of nature that can cause destruction on a massive scale. Wildfires can rage out of control, destroying entire forests and leaving nothing but ash in their wake. The sound of a forest fire is a crackling roar, punctuated by explosions as trees and plants burst into flames.

The Power of Volcanoes

Volcanoes are some of the most powerful forces of nature, capable of shaping entire landscapes and altering the course of history. The sound of a volcano is a deep, rumbling growl, punctuated by explosions as lava and ash are expelled from the earth. The power of a volcano can be both beautiful and terrifying, a reminder of the immense forces that exist beneath our feet.

The Wrath of Hurricanes

Hurricanes are massive storms that can cause widespread destruction and devastation. The sound of a hurricane is a constant roar, as the wind howls and rain lashes down. The waves generated by a hurricane can be enormous, capable of causing severe flooding and coastal erosion. Despite their destructive power, hurricanes are also a reminder of the beauty and majesty of the natural world.
